Opposable Thumbs
Thumbs that can be moved to touch the opposite fingers of the hand, a trait allowing for greater manipulation and grasp capability.
Adaptation
The process by which a species becomes better suited to its environment through changes in its characteristics over time.
Stereoscopic Vision
The ability to perceive depth and three-dimensional structure from visual information captured by both eyes.
Primates
An order of mammals that includes humans, apes, monkeys, and prosimians, characterized by large brains, forward-facing eyes, and opposable thumbs.
